Medical records
When filing a truck-related accident case, medical records are very crucial. They contain specific details about the accident as well as the treatment received by the victim. These records could include details about the outcome and the cost of treatment. These records could also contain details about the future treatment options and the anticipated costs. For this reason, it is crucial that the injured party obtain these records to ensure they get the compensation they deserve.
Before deciding on whether to accept your claim the insurance company will have to look over your medical records. They will also want to review them to ensure that they are accurate and pertain to your claim. If you have questions it is best to seek legal advice. They can assist you in how to present your medical records in the most favorable light.
You should carefully read any medical release you sign. The records could contain sensitive information about you. Your insurance company may not be aware that you have given them confidential information from your medical records. The insurance company is likely to request to review your medical records prior to conducting a thorough investigation of the claim you filed for a truck accident.
Your attorney will be able examine the details of your truck accident case, including medical records. The records can also be used to document your recovery and future medical needs. This information is useful when requesting reimbursement from the insurance company. It may be difficult to prove that you were the victim in the case that the records are not complete.
These records will be used by your lawyer to disprove the claims made by the insurance company. If you have a preexisting medical condition, be sure you disclose it to your attorney. This means that your attorney can disprove any claims from insurance companies that your injuries were caused by the accident. If you had a previous health issue that was made worse by the accident, then you may still be eligible to claim damages for it.
Police crash reports
Your truck accident claim will be based on the police crash reports. Insurance companies make use of them to determine the cause of the accident and calculate compensation claims. However, the report may not reflect the true facts of the incident. Therefore, it's important to check the report of the police for any mistakes and to contact the investigating officer if necessary.
The report of the police crash contains many important facts about the incident. It also contains the officer's assessment of the cause of the accident and the contributing factors. The causes could be bad weather, speeding, not working brake lights or turn signals and even turn signals that aren't working. Traffic laws that are violated are also recorded in police crash reports. It is important to understand that these reports are not legally binding however they do have importance. You can appeal the content of the report to the court if you are unhappy with them.
The report of a police crash will contain the police officer's opinion on the causes of the crash, information on witnesses, and the position of each party that was involved in the accident. The report will also include a diagram of where the crash took place and the point of impact. The documents are usually completed within a couple of days. Certain jurisdictions make these documents available to the public and others limit their release to the driver involved. Depending on the nature of your claim, the police report on your crash could impact the outcome of your injury claim.
The police crash reports are an essential piece of evidence in your truck accident case. They provide vital information that will allow you to get an equitable settlement. These reports often include details about injuries and citations. They may also include photos of the scene.

Timeline of claim
Gathering evidence, interviewing witnesses, and taking depositions are all a part of the procedure for filing a truck accident lawsuit. To build your case and provide accurate information to your insurer, you'll need financial documents and medical information. Alongside these steps, you will also need to wait for the documents you've requested to be processed.
A claim for damages from a truck accident could be complicated, particularly in cases where the accident wasn't your responsibility. Insurance companies typically negotiate on your behalf to reduce the cost. It's important to remember that these goals don't always align with the goals of the injured party. These issues can be resolved by an experienced attorney. In addition to helping you gather evidence, your lawyer can help you prepare for negotiations with insurers. You'll be able to guard yourself from making mistakes that can reduce your payout.
After gathering evidence that supports your claim, your truck accident case can proceed to the mediation or trial stage. If mediation fails, your lawyer will present evidence to a judge or jury to decide the amount of your claim for compensation. In this phase, your attorney will present evidence to prove that the driver of the truck was at fault for the accident, and that you suffered injuries and expenses. If you can convince the jury of the maximum compensation amount in your truck accident case, it could be successful.
You'll need to collect and release medical records if injured in a truck crash. The medical records will help determine the severity of your injuries and the impact they had on your daily life. Information about your future medical needs will also be required.
